乔布斯还希望微软能为Mac电脑编写一些应用软件,如文字处理软件、图表和电子表格程序。当时,乔布斯已功成名就,盖茨还只是个跟班:1982年,苹果公司的年销售额达10亿美元,而微软只有3 200万美元。盖茨签下了合同,除BASIC程序外,还为苹果公司开发图形界面版本的软件——全新的电子表格软件Excel和文字处理程序Word。
GitHub的开源编辑器Atom在微软收购之后被抛弃,为vscode让位。 微软这波操作不得不说很让人遗憾。
Atom创始人强势开新坑,新编辑器叫Zed,全盘用Rust语言编写。
除了全部用Rust编写,值得注意的是,Zed不使用Electron,而是参考Mozilla的同样使用Rust编写的开源项目Webrender,重新写一个原生支持GPU的UI,就叫“GPUI”。达到像素级反应的性能。
另外使用CRDTs来实现无冲突协作更新,不出意外使用同为Atom创始团队的Zed团队成员Abtonio写的Rust版本CRDT库,Ditto。
最后,将使用Tree-sitter来进行支持50多种语言的语法解析。 Tree-sitter作者,也是Atom创始团队的Max也加入了Zed团队。
此次Zed创始团队强大,Rust语言又扳回一城,Zed编辑器未来可期。
cake 1.0.0构建工具发布了,它是一个构建工具,采用c#编写,支持c#的语法。可以理解为gradle,sbt这样的工具链。cake是微软主导开发的。